Emmanuel Acho and Cam Newton have engaged in a public dispute regarding the success of their respective podcasts. Newton argued that his show, 4th&1, has a more organically built audience compared to Acho's Speakeasy, which he claims is better produced. Acho countered by referencing Newton's past comments about competing in strip clubs, suggesting that Newton's audience growth may not be entirely organic. Both former NFL players have transitioned from television roles to successful podcast endeavors, with Acho's Speakeasy boasting 2.61 million subscribers, while Newton's 4th&1 has over 557,000 subscribers since its launch in 2023.
